Risk factors for optic disc hemorrhage in the low-pressure glaucoma treatment study
Rafael L Furlanetto1, Carlos Gustavo De Moraes2, Christopher C Teng2
1Einhorn Clinical Research Center, New York Eye and Ear Infirmary, New York, New York.
Migraine, narrower neuroretinal rim, low blood pressure, and systemic beta-blocker use are key risk factors for disc hemorrhage in low-pressure glaucoma. Treatment assignment did not impact hemorrhage occurrence or recurrence.

Background:
- Disc hemorrhage is a clinical sign in glaucoma, particularly in low-tension glaucoma.
- Identifying risk factors for disc hemorrhage is crucial for predicting glaucoma progression.
Purpose of the Study:
- To investigate ocular and systemic risk factors associated with the detection of disc hemorrhage in the Low-Pressure Glaucoma Treatment Study.
- To determine if treatment randomization influenced disc hemorrhage occurrence or recurrence.
Main Methods:
- Analysis of a cohort from a randomized, double-masked, multicenter clinical trial (Low-Pressure Glaucoma Treatment Study).
- Inclusion of patients with at least 16 months of follow-up, excluding those with high intraocular pressure (IOP) or severe visual field loss.
- Stereophotographs were reviewed for disc hemorrhages, and Cox proportional hazards models were used to analyze risk factors.
Main Results:
- Migraine history (HR, 5.737), narrower baseline neuroretinal rim width (HR, 2.91), systemic beta-blocker use (HR, 5.585), low mean systolic blood pressure (HR, 1.06), and low mean arterial ocular perfusion pressure (HR, 1.172) were significant independent risk factors for disc hemorrhage detection.
- Treatment randomization to timolol or brimonidine did not affect the occurrence or recurrence of disc hemorrhages.
Conclusions:
- Migraine, narrower neuroretinal rim, low blood pressure, low ocular perfusion pressure, and systemic beta-blocker use are identified as significant risk factors for disc hemorrhage in low-pressure glaucoma.
- The study did not find an association between treatment randomization and the frequency of disc hemorrhage detection.
